A clear path from problem to release.

01

Measure the baseline

Confirm tracking, ownership, index status, current queries, landing pages and conversion signals.

02

Repair the foundation

Resolve crawl, canonical, performance, metadata, structured-data and internal-link issues by priority.

03

Match useful intent

Create or improve pages that answer a real search need and support a relevant business action.

04

Learn and iterate

Review query and conversion evidence, refresh useful content and address emerging technical issues.

Frequently asked.

Can you guarantee first-page rankings?

No responsible provider can guarantee a position controlled by search engines and competitors. We improve the controllable technical, content, relevance and measurement factors and report the evidence.

How long does SEO take?

Technical fixes can be validated quickly, while meaningful ranking and demand growth usually require sustained crawling, content improvement, authority and competitive progress.
